740.00119 European War 1939/2551: Telegram

The Secretary of State to the Chargé in the Soviet Union (Hamilton)

1080. Your 1514, April 29. The release of the tripartite statement was held up at the last minute at the request of the British Foreign Office. Since last Thursday56 nothing whatever has been heard from London on the matter and the British Embassy here states that it has received no reply to its telegram asking for the reasons for the postponement and for a proposal for a new release date.

The Department has requested the Embassy at London57 urgently to take up the matter with the Foreign Office and to inform you of its reply. We think that the statement should be used now if it is to be effective, particularly in view of Stalin’s treatment of the same matter in his order of the day.58

Hull
